Met inspection standards. 4 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.
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Observed in stand alone cooler raw shell eggs stored over ready to eat sprinkles. Employee removed and stored properly.
No paper towels or mechanical hand drying device provided at handwash sink. Observed no paper towels at employee hand sink.employee provided paper towels for hand sink.
Food not stored at least 6 inches off of the floor. Observed case of bottled water stored on floor. Observed case of ice cream cones stored on floor. Employee removed and stored properly.
Single-service articles improperly stored. Observed single service lids stored on floor in kitchen. Employee removed and stored properly.
